According to the statistics released by the Turkish Statistics Institute (TUIK), Turkey's monthly industrial turnover index in April this year increased by 4.6 percent compared to the same month of the previous year and was down one percent month on month, following the 13.2 percent month-on-month increase recorded in March.
In April, the industrial turnover index for the manufacture of basic metals in Turkey increased by six percent year on year and registered a 0.6 percent fall from the previous month, after a rise of 7.6 percent in March compared to February. In April, the industrial turnover index for fabricated metal product manufacturing, except machinery and equipment, increased 6.8 percent year on year and fell slightly by 0.2 percent from the previous month, following a 13.9 percent increase in March compared to February.
The turnover of the domestic sales of Turkish basic metals manufacturing increased by 4.9 percent in April, while foreign sales were down by 10.5 percent, month on month. In the month in question, a 7.3 percent month-on-month increase was recorded in the domestic sales turnover in manufacture of fabricated metal products, with foreign sales decreasing by 15.1 percent, compared to the previous month.
